Q. What is the difference between mussels and octopuses regarding their circulatory systems? How does that difference influence the mobility of these animals?
Cephalopod molluscs like octopuses and squids have a closed circulatory system with blood pumped under pressure flowing within vessels Bivalve molluscs like oysters and mussels have an open circulatory system that also known as lacunar circulatory system where blood flows under low pressure since it falls in cavities of the body and doesn't only circulate within blood vessels. Molluscs with closed circulatory systems are larger agile and can actively move molluscs with open circulatory systems are slow, smaller and some are practically sessile.
